[KIP, Johannes].
The North Prospect of the City of Edenburgh.
The North Prospect of the City of Edenburgh.
Stock Code 85254
[London, c.1720].
Edinburgh
A fine prospect of Edinburgh taken from Britannia Illustrata. Known as the 'Queen Anne View'. High in the sky above the city the rococo banderole of the title is suspended between two putti. The panorama shows the city in one long line from (left to right) from Holyrood Palace to Edinburgh Castle. Salisbury Crag and Arthur's Seat are seen in the background.Large engraved panorama on 3 joined sheets, 45 x 108 cm., engraved by Kip after Leonard Knyff, short splits to head and tail of centrefold, a clean, crisp, impression.
